India will lock horns with Oman in their final Asia Cup 2025 Group A fixture at Abu Dhabi’s Sheikh Zayed Stadium on Thursday, September 19. Having already sealed a spot in the Super 4, Rohit Sharma’s men enter this clash unbeaten and eyeing a third consecutive win before their much-anticipated encounter with Pakistan. India’s Campaign So Far
- India began the tournament with a commanding nine-wicket win over the UAE, followed by a confident seven-wicket triumph against Pakistan.
- With two wins in two matches, India have already topped their group, making this match a formality in terms of qualification but an important opportunity to refine their combinations.
Team India’s Focus: Rotation and Experiments
Since the result won’t affect standings, India’s management may experiment with the playing XI:
- Jasprit Bumrah could be rested to manage his workload, giving youngsters like Arshdeep Singh or Harshit Rana valuable game time.
- Sanju Samson, yet to bat in the competition, might be promoted in the order to test his readiness for pressure situations.
- The match also gives a chance to give bench players exposure before the tougher stages of the tournament.
Oman’s Motivation: Pride and Learning
Oman, already out of the competition after defeats to Pakistan and the UAE, approach this game with a different mindset. For them, playing India is less about the result and more about gaining experience against one of the world’s strongest teams.
This contest also helps Oman prepare for upcoming international challenges, including the T20 World Cup Asia Qualifiers, where lessons from such matches could prove crucial.
